opensbi/include/sbi/riscv_unpriv.h
Anup Patel a22c6891b7 include: Make unprivilege load/store functions as non-inline functions
Currently, the unprivilege load/store functions are inline functions.

We will be extending these functions to track whether a page/access
fault occurs when we execute unprivilege load/store instruction.

To make things simpler and debugable, we reduce number of places which
can potentially generate a page/access fault by making all unprivilege
load/store functions as regular (non-inline) functions.

#ifndef __RISCV_UNPRIV_H__
#define __RISCV_UNPRIV_H__
#include <sbi/sbi_types.h>
#define DECLARE_UNPRIVILEGED_LOAD_FUNCTION(type) \
type load_##type(const type *addr);
#define DECLARE_UNPRIVILEGED_STORE_FUNCTION(type) \
void store_##type(type *addr, type val);
DECLARE_UNPRIVILEGED_LOAD_FUNCTION(u8)
DECLARE_UNPRIVILEGED_LOAD_FUNCTION(u16)
DECLARE_UNPRIVILEGED_LOAD_FUNCTION(s8)
DECLARE_UNPRIVILEGED_LOAD_FUNCTION(s16)
DECLARE_UNPRIVILEGED_LOAD_FUNCTION(s32)
DECLARE_UNPRIVILEGED_STORE_FUNCTION(u8)
DECLARE_UNPRIVILEGED_STORE_FUNCTION(u16)
DECLARE_UNPRIVILEGED_STORE_FUNCTION(u32)
DECLARE_UNPRIVILEGED_LOAD_FUNCTION(u32)
DECLARE_UNPRIVILEGED_LOAD_FUNCTION(u64)
DECLARE_UNPRIVILEGED_STORE_FUNCTION(u64)
DECLARE_UNPRIVILEGED_LOAD_FUNCTION(ulong)
ulong get_insn(ulong mepc, ulong *mstatus);
#endif
